    WESTERN SOUTH ATLANTIC.
    BRAZIL-SOUTHEAST COAST.
    DNC 01.
    1. UNDERWATER OPERATIONS 1100Z TO 2000Z DAILY
       30 MAY THRU 30 JUL BY M/V BEKS HALIL,
       M/V ZATTO AND M/V COMANDO B IN
       20-22.25S 040-08.63W.
       WIDE BERTH REQUESTED.
    2. CANCEL THIS MSG 302100Z JUL 19.
